Sponsor's own description
In our study, we primarily aimed to compare the postoperative analgesic effectiveness of the Serratus Posterior Superior Intercostal Plane Block and the Serratus Anterior Plane Block, both routinely applied in patients undergoing Video-Assisted Thoracoscopic Surgery (VATS)
